This document provides rules and guidelines for the classification and designation of information containers based on their inherent content. This document is applicable for information used in the life cycle of a system, e.g., industrial plants, construction entities and equipment. This document defines classes of information and their information kind classification code (ICC). The defined classes and codes provided are used as values associated with metadata, e.g., in information management systems (see IEC 82045-1 and IEC 82045-2). The rules, guidelines and classes are general and are applicable to all technical areas, for example, mechanical engineering, electrical engineering, construction engineering and process engineering. They can be used for systems based on different technologies or for systems combining several technologies. This document also has the status of a horizontal publication in accordance with IEC Guide 108. It is intended for use by technical committees in preparation of publications related to classification and designation of information. IEC 81355-1:2024 cancels and replaces the second edition of IEC 61355-1 published in 2008. This edition constitutes a technical revision. This edition includes the following significant technical changes with respect to IEC 61355-1:2008: a) focusing on classification of information rather that classification of document kinds; b) introduced a classification scheme based on inherent content of information; c) introduced a distinction between an information container and a document, the latter being for human perception; d) introduction of information kind classification code (ICC), replacing document kind classification code (DCC); e) introduced structuring of information containers; f) introduced an information model of the concepts dealt with; g) introduced a conversion table for merging from the use of DCC to the use of ICC.

Overview
IEC 81355-1:2024 (published jointly by IEC and ISO) establishes basic rules and a classification scheme for information used across the life cycle of industrial systems, installations, equipment and products. The standard shifts focus from paper-based “document kinds” to the classification of information containers by their inherent content, introducing the new Information Kind Classification Code (ICC) to replace the older Document Kind Classification Code (DCC). It defines concepts, an information model, naming and structuring rules for information containers, and a conversion table to migrate from DCC to ICC.
Key topics and requirements
- Classification by inherent content: Information is classified according to what it contains, independent of its presentation or intended use.
- Information container concept: Distinguishes an information container (persistent, named set of information) from a document (for human perception). Containers can be structured (models, databases) or unstructured (text, video).
- Information Kind Classification Code (ICC): A coded taxonomy for tagging information containers as metadata values to enable consistent categorization and retrieval.
- Designation and relation rules: Rules for designating information containers and linking them to one or more objects (systems, components) to support traceability across the lifecycle.
- Structuring and sub-containers: Guidance for subdividing and organizing information containers (e.g., chapters, layers, sub-models).
- Information model and migration support: Includes a conceptual model of terms and a conversion table for transitioning from DCC to ICC.
- Metadata usage: ICC codes are intended for use in information management systems and metadata schemes (compatible with IEC 82045 series).
